What's the procedure for showers at the MIA Term D AC?

In my experience, every AC has a similar procedure for using the showers: you ask at the desk for a key; if one is available they give it to you, and if not they add your name to a waiting list; after you've showered you return the key to the desk, and they confirm that the shower has been cleaned before giving that key out again. Couldn't be more straightforward.

Not so at the MIA Term D AC, at least not last night. I went to the desk to ask for a key, and it was like they'd never been asked that question before. The woman at the desk in front of the elevators -- the one whom I had asked -- glanced over to the separate service desk, but there was no one was there. She then typed furiously on her keyboard for a while before calling a number that went unanswered. She then paged someone who did not respond. After waiting about 5 minutes, she flagged down an AC employee who was walking by. This woman walked me and one other guy (who had come to inquire about a shower at about the same time) over to the showers, and having no idea which ones might be in use, banged on each door to see if she got a response before letting each of us in.

...? Is this the way they normally operate?
